JOB SUMMARY

To perform a variety of commercial lines and or personal lines tasks - related to processing basic and complex transactions for renewals; quotes; new business; money endorsements; and non-money endorsements, for all products.  Process basic and complex cancellations. 

D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ES

>Primary

  • Enter required risk data and process basic and complex renewals for all products.
  • Update Statement of Values for blanket renewal policies, and send the SOV with a letter to the agent. 
  • Verify that the renewal meets the underwriting criteria and review with the Underwriter any discrepancies.
  • Enter required risk data and process basic and complex new business for all products.
  • Verify that the rated account meets the underwriting criteria and review with the Underwriter any discrepancies.
  • Enter required risk data and process basic and complex money endorsement requests for all products. 
  • Verify accurate Reinsurance entry in WINS for all applicable transactions.
  • Enter required risk data and rate basic and complex quotes for all products.
  • Verify that the rated quote contains all of the requested information.
  • Process basic cancellations (final cancels, reinstatements) and complex cancellations (notices in system and manually, revisions to original cancellation or non-renewal, Add from Cancels with additional changes)
  • Keep up-to-date on all current department procedures related to processing various transactions. 
  • Performs other duties or special projects as required or as assigned.

 

>Secondary

  • Enter policy application data into system for various personal lines products.
  • Register Quotes and New Business for commercial lines products.

SUPERVISION RECEIVED

Moderate to minimal supervision is received from the Underwriting Service Manager or senior staff.

QUALIFICATIONS

  • High school education plus 2-4 years relevant experience; or a combination of education and experience from which comparable knowledge and skills are acquired.  
  • Strong math skills; good reading, spelling, typing/data entry and general clerical skills.
  • Previous experience working with computerized information systems, Windows systems preferred.
  • Previous insurance industry experience helpful.
  • Ability to effectively & cooperatively work with company personnel, as well as the ability to represent the company and deal effectively with agents, as well as others outside the company.
  • Proficiency using automated phone systems, e-mail and general word processing.
  • Experience with AS/400, Imageright, and Microsoft Outlook preferred.
